<p><strong>Bamboo</strong></p>
<p>This fast-growing and very friendly plant definitely occupies the first place. This plant can survive entirely in water. Some varieties can grow up to 40 inches in a single day.</p>
<p><strong>Willow tree</strong></p>
<p>I am ready to bet that even a school-boy knows that all willows love water &#8211; they grow very quick and can be named rather seamlessly growing plants. </p>
<p><strong>Bee balm</strong></p>
<p>This plant is charming. I love how quickly they grow, how awesome they smell and the fact the leaves can be crushed and used for tea.</p>
